trif则主要介导tlr3和tlr4的信号。被tram募集至tlr4或直接与tlr3结合后,一方面trif与traf6及traf3相互作用,通过rip-1激酶激活tak1以活化nf-κb和mapk信号通路;另一方面,traf3募集ikk家族的tbk1和ikki激酶,磷酸化修饰转录因子irf3使其活化二聚入核诱导表达一型干扰素基因。
TICAM1 - Wikipedia
TIR domain containing adaptor molecule 1 (TICAM1; formerly known as TIR-domain-containing adapter-inducing interferon-β or TRIF) is an adapter in responding to activation of toll-like receptors (TLRs). It mediates the rather delayed cascade of two TLR-associated signaling cascades, where the other one is dependent upon a MyD88 adapter. [5]

trif招募traf6并激活tak1以激活nf-κb,很可能是通过泛素化依赖的机制,类似于myd88依赖的途径。 TRIF还通过独特的RIP同型相互作用基序招募适配器RIP1。 在TLR3激动剂的刺激下,RIP1经历了K63连锁的多泛素化,这一修饰是NF-κB激活所必需的。
